Cranberry Jalapeno Dip

This Cranberry Jalapeno Dip is amazing. I had it at my friend Kristie’s Cookies and Cocktails Party and I immediately decided to make it for New Year’s Eve. My husband really liked it too!

Be sure to give this recipe a try! I really loved the flavor and the combination of the sweet and slight spice. My husband doesn’t like spicy, and we didn’t find this to be at all. Just be sure you deseed your jalapenos unless you like spice.

I think this would taste amazing over goat cheese too! Serve with any crackers of your choice. I served mine with gluten free to keep this appetizer something that I could enjoy but you could use any type of cracker you like. I think a butter cracker or town cracker would be nice.

I hope you enjoy this Cranberry Jalapeno Dip as much as we did. My husband said it was really festive and perfect for Christmas. I plan to serve it next year on Christmas Eve.

Cranberry Jalapeno Dip

This Cranberry Jalapeno Dip is amazing. I had it at my friend Kristie's Cookies and Cocktails Party and I immediately decided to make it for New Year's Eve. My husband really liked it too!
Print Recipe
Prep Time:12 hours 10 minutes

Equipment

  • 1 glass pie pan

Ingredients

  • 16 oz. fresh or frozen cranberries, chopped
  • 2 whole fresh jalapenos, seeded and chopped
  • 1/3 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 2 boxes cream cheese, softened
  • 3 TBSP fresh lime juice, bottled is ok
  • 1 box crackers of your choice

Instructions

  • Using a food processor or blender chop up your cranberries, jalapenos and cilantro. I like this to be a very chopped consistency so that the flavors blend.
  • Add 1/2 cup sugar and fresh lime juice and place into a covered dish and refrigerate up to 24 hours. I advise at least 12 hours.
  • Soften your cream cheese until it is spreadable. You can transfer to the pie pan and even heat it for 30 seconds. Spread until creamy and smooth in the pie pan.
  • Drain off any extra liquid and pour over the cream cheese.
  • Enjoy this delicious appetizer with crackers of your choice. I use gluten free crackers personally, but a butter cracker or club cracker would be nice.
Servings: 8 people
